Chromium Code Reviews| Index: ash/common/shell_window_ids.h |
| diff --git a/ash/shell_window_ids.h b/ash/common/shell_window_ids.h |
| similarity index 80% |
| rename from ash/shell_window_ids.h |
| rename to ash/common/shell_window_ids.h |
| index cb578cc1d52d96b2be455fe20afe29ca12719be5..8681e9c5d44b01e4c39077611d8583431bfc8dca 100644 |
| --- a/ash/shell_window_ids.h |
| +++ b/ash/common/shell_window_ids.h |
| @@ -2,10 +2,8 @@ |
| // Use of this source code is governed by a BSD-style license that can be |
| // found in the LICENSE file. |
| -#ifndef ASH_SHELL_WINDOW_IDS_H_ |
| -#define ASH_SHELL_WINDOW_IDS_H_ |
| - |
| -#include "ash/common/wm/wm_shell_window_ids.h" |
| +#ifndef ASH_COMMON_SHELL_WINDOW_IDS_H_ |
| +#define ASH_COMMON_SHELL_WINDOW_IDS_H_ |
| // Declarations of ids of special shell windows. |
| @@ -28,8 +26,8 @@ const int kShellWindowId_LockScreenContainersContainer = 1; |
| const int kShellWindowId_LockScreenRelatedContainersContainer = 2; |
| // A container used for windows of WINDOW_TYPE_CONTROL that have no parent. |
| -// This container is not visible. Defined in wm_shell_window_ids. |
| -// kShellWindowId_UnparentedControlContainer = 3; |
| +// This container is not visible. |
| +const int kShellWindowId_UnparentedControlContainer = 3; |
| // The desktop background window. |
| const int kShellWindowId_DesktopBackgroundContainer = 4; |
| @@ -37,41 +35,38 @@ const int kShellWindowId_DesktopBackgroundContainer = 4; |
| // The virtual keyboard container. |
| const int kShellWindowId_VirtualKeyboardContainer = 5; |
| -// The container for standard top-level windows. Defined in wm_shell_window_ids. |
| -// kShellWindowId_DefaultContainer = 6; |
| +// The container for standard top-level windows. |
| +const int kShellWindowId_DefaultContainer = 6; |
| // The container for top-level windows with the 'always-on-top' flag set. |
| -// kShellWindowId_AlwaysOnTopContainer = 7; |
| +const int kShellWindowId_AlwaysOnTopContainer = 7; |
| -// The container for windows docked to either side of the desktop. Defined in |
| -// wm_shell_window_ids. |
| -// kShellWindowId_DockedContainer = 8; |
| +// The container for windows docked to either side of the desktop. |
| +const int kShellWindowId_DockedContainer = 8; |
| -// The container for the shelf. Defined in wm_shell_window_ids. |
| -// kShellWindowId_ShelfContainer = 9; |
| +// The container for the shelf. |
| +const int kShellWindowId_ShelfContainer = 9; |
| // The container for bubbles which float over the shelf. |
| const int kShellWindowId_ShelfBubbleContainer = 10; |
| -// The container for panel windows. Defined in wm_shell_window_ids. |
| -// kShellWindowId_PanelContainer = 11; |
| +// The container for panel windows. |
| +const int kShellWindowId_PanelContainer = 11; |
| -// The container for the app list. Defined in wm_shell_window_ids. |
| -// kShellWindowId_AppListContainer = 12; |
| +// The container for the app list. |
| +const int kShellWindowId_AppListContainer = 12; |
| -// The container for user-specific modal windows. Defined in |
| -// wm_shell_window_ids |
| -// kShellWindowId_SystemModalContainer = 13; |
| +// The container for user-specific modal windows. |
| +const int kShellWindowId_SystemModalContainer = 13; |
| // The container for the lock screen background. |
| const int kShellWindowId_LockScreenBackgroundContainer = 14; |
| -// The container for the lock screen. Defined in wm_shell_window_ids. |
| -// kShellWindowId_LockScreenContainer = 15; |
| +// The container for the lock screen. |
| +const int kShellWindowId_LockScreenContainer = 15; |
| -// The container for the lock screen modal windows. Defined in |
| -// wm_shell_window_ids. |
| -// kShellWindowId_LockSystemModalContainer = 16; |
| +// The container for the lock screen modal windows. |
| +const int kShellWindowId_LockSystemModalContainer = 16; |
| // The container for the status area. |
| const int kShellWindowId_StatusContainer = 17; |
| @@ -81,24 +76,22 @@ const int kShellWindowId_StatusContainer = 17; |
| // above most containers but below the mouse cursor and the power off animation. |
| const int kShellWindowId_ImeWindowParentContainer = 18; |
| -// The container for menus. Defined in wm_shell_window_ids. |
| -// kShellWindowId_MenuContainer = 19; |
| +// The container for menus. |
| +const int kShellWindowId_MenuContainer = 19; |
| -// The container for drag/drop images and tooltips. Defined in |
| -// wm_shell_window_ids. |
| -// const int kShellWindowId_DragImageAndTooltipContainer = 20; |
| +// The container for drag/drop images and tooltips. |
| +const int kShellWindowId_DragImageAndTooltipContainer = 20; |
| // The container for bubbles briefly overlaid onscreen to show settings changes |
| // (volume, brightness, input method bubbles, etc.). |
| const int kShellWindowId_SettingBubbleContainer = 21; |
| // The container for special components overlaid onscreen, such as the |
| -// region selector for partial screenshots. Defined in wm_shell_window_ids. |
| -// const int kShellWindowId_OverlayContainer = 22; |
| +// region selector for partial screenshots. |
| +const int kShellWindowId_OverlayContainer = 22; |
| // ID of the window created by PhantomWindowController or DragWindowController. |
| -// Defined in wm_shell_window_ids. |
| -// kShellWindowId_PhantomWindow = 23; |
| +const int kShellWindowId_PhantomWindow = 23; |
| // The container for mouse cursor. |
| const int kShellWindowId_MouseCursorContainer = 24; |
| @@ -106,6 +99,9 @@ const int kShellWindowId_MouseCursorContainer = 24; |
| // The topmost container, used for power off animation. |
| const int kShellWindowId_PowerButtonAnimationContainer = 25; |
| +// TODO(sky): remove. Temporary for rietveld to pick up file move rather than |
|
sky
2016/06/01 19:52:04
I'll TBR a patch to remove the static_asserts afte
James Cook
2016/06/01 20:58:32
Acknowledged.
|
| +// new file. |
| + |
| static_assert((kShellWindowId_UnparentedControlContainer - 1 == |
| kShellWindowId_LockScreenRelatedContainersContainer) && |
| (kShellWindowId_UnparentedControlContainer + 1 == |
| @@ -194,4 +190,4 @@ static_assert((kShellWindowId_PhantomWindow - 1 == |
| } // namespace ash |
| -#endif // ASH_SHELL_WINDOW_IDS_H_ |
| +#endif // ASH_COMMON_SHELL_WINDOW_IDS_H_ |